How they compare
Algeria currently reports 0.05 % against 0.02 % in India, a difference of 0.03 %.
That makes Algeria's figure about 2.5 times India's.
The two have swapped places 9 times across 34 shared years of data; in 1990 it was India ahead.
Algeria ranks 94th and India ranks 96th of 187 countries.
Algeria has averaged higher in every one of the 4 decades both report.

About this data
The FAOSTAT domain on Emissions indicators disseminates indicators on sectoral shares of total national greenhouse gas (GHG) emissions as well as three indicators of emissions intensity: per capita emissions; emissions per value of agricultural production; and emissions per area of agricultural land.
